Quick Observation

We found 3-5cm of moist surface snow from valley bottom to 1800m, this new snow was overlaying a recently formed melt freeze crust. Above 1800m the snow quality improved and the near surface crust tapered. While setting an up track on a South aspect at 2200m we experience two large whumphs. We decided to dig a test profile (SEE PHOTO). We suspect the whumphs were failing on the Feb 16 crust down 30cm. An ECT from the test profile produced hard results on the same interface.
